    Top 10 Inspiring Quotes About a Woman's Intuition

    Quotes have a way of capturing the essence of complex ideas in a few powerful words. Here are ten gems that perfectly encapsulate the power of a woman’s intuition:

    • “Trust yourself. You know more than you think you do.” — Benjamin Spock
    • “Intuition is always right in at least two important ways; it is always in touch with truth, and it is always in touch with you.” — Shakti Gawain
    • “A woman’s intuition is one of the most powerful forces in the universe.” — Unknown
    • “Your intuition knows what’s best for you even if your mind doesn’t understand it yet.” — Unknown
    • “Never underestimate the power of a woman’s intuition.” — Unknown
    • “Intuition is the whisper of divine wisdom.” — Unknown
    • “The greatest power a woman possesses is her intuition.” — Unknown
    • “When a woman trusts her intuition, she becomes unstoppable.” — Unknown
    • “Follow your gut—it’s smarter than you think.” — Unknown
    • “Intuition is the voice of the soul.” — Unknown

    Practical Tips for Strengthening Your Intuition

    Ready to tap into your inner wisdom? Here are a few tips to help you sharpen your intuition:

    • Practice mindfulness meditation to quiet your mind and tune into your feelings.
    • Keep a journal to track patterns in your thoughts and emotions.
    • Pay attention to physical sensations, like butterflies in your stomach or a tightness in your chest—they’re often signs of your intuition at work.
    • Trust your first instinct, especially in situations where you have limited information.
    • Surround yourself with positive influences that encourage self-trust.

    Common Misconceptions About Female Intuition

    Despite its proven power, female intuition is still surrounded by myths and misconceptions. One of the biggest is the idea that it’s purely emotional. In reality, intuition is a complex interplay of emotion, experience, and logic. Another common misconception is that it’s always right. While intuition is incredibly reliable, it’s not infallible. Sometimes, our biases or past experiences can cloud our judgment.

    But here’s the thing: just because intuition isn’t perfect doesn’t mean it’s not valuable. The key is to use it as a guide, not a rulebook. Trust your gut, but don’t be afraid to seek additional information or advice when needed.

    Breaking Down the Myths

    Let’s tackle some of these misconceptions head-on:

    • Myth: Intuition is only for women. Fact: Men have intuition too, though it may manifest differently.
    • Myth: Intuition is always emotional. Fact: It’s a combination of emotion, experience, and logic.
    • Myth: Intuition is always right. Fact: It’s a powerful tool, but not infallible.
